One thing (out of many reasons) why I love photographing weddings is exploring new places. Teresa and Ryan are such a sweet and fun couple and we shot at two great locations. The fall weather was on point with a little bit of a crisp at Enders State Forest and Saville Dam.

We started at the park and Teresa braved rock climbing in wedges so I could get some great shots by the waterfalls. We chatted about football (turns out Ryan is a Cowboys fan so it was fate) and Game of Thrones and they let me try some new photo techniques without a beat.. when I said "trust me" they did and that's all I could ask for.

Next July can not come soon enough when they say 'I Do' at a charming rustic venue Maneely's in South Windsor, Connecticut.
